Vasse Felix Heytesbury Cabernet Petit Verdot Malbec 2009 is a powerful yet polished Margaret River red from one of Western Australia’s most celebrated wine estates. Founded in 1967, Vasse Felix was Margaret River’s first commercial vineyard, and the Heytesbury range continues to showcase the region’s outstanding potential for premium Cabernet Sauvignon.
Cabernet Sauvignon leads this distinguished blend, with Petit Verdot and Malbec contributing depth, colour and complexity. Rich layers of cassis, blackberry, dark chocolate, violet and subtle spice unfold across the palate, supported by fine, composed tannins and impressive length. The 2009 vintage delivers an excellent balance of power, structure and refinement.
